Full Description

Show more
Supplies LED fixtures and lighting control hardware for prime contractors on National Park Service projects at Gettysburg National Military Park. Provides LED-compatible dimming hardware and scene-based/scheduled control components. Must comply with Buy American-Construction Materials (FAR 52.225-9) and provide manufacturer warranties. Delivers lighting fixtures and control hardware to the project site.

99--REPRODUCTION WALLPAPER AND CARPET FOR THE IRONMAST
Solicitation # 140P4226Q0021
Solicitation 140P4226Q0021 is a firm-fixed-price request for proposals issued by the National Park Service Northeast Regional Contracting Office for the reproduction of wallpaper and carpet for the Ironmasters Furnishing Plan at Hopewell Furnace National Historic Site in Elverson, Pennsylvania. This project requires the professional installation of exact reproductions of historic patterns dating from 1830 to 1880, including specific styles such as Wilton, Ingrain, and Venetian Striped carpets, and various wallpaper types across approximately 65 rolls. The contract is a total set-aside for small businesses under NAICS code 541410. The period of performance is scheduled from September 21, 2026, to September 20, 2027, with a final delivery deadline of September 20, 2027. Award will be based on the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) method. Offerors must be rated as technically acceptable across three primary factors: technical capability, which includes a technical approach document, at least three relevant projects from the past five years, and biobased certification; contractor compliance, requiring active SAM registration and completed provisions; and pricing. Proposals must be submitted electronically via email to Deborah Coles by September 4, 2026, in two separate volumes: a PDF for technical capabilities and an editable Excel workbook for pricing. The contractor is responsible for providing materials with a 10% surplus for inventory and must adhere to OSHA safety standards and National Park Service historical preservation guidelines.

J--INDE Annual Fire Alarm ITM and As-Needed Repair Se
Solicitation # 140P4226Q0046
Solicitation 140P4226Q0046 is a small business set-aside for the National Park Service to obtain annual fire alarm inspection, testing, and maintenance (ITM) and as-needed repair services for Independence National Historical Park in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. The scope of work involves the maintenance of various fire protection devices, including control panels, smoke and heat detectors, and pull stations across multiple park facilities. The contract is structured with a base period from April 14, 2026, to April 30, 2027, and four subsequent one-year option periods, with a total potential duration not to exceed 66 months. Technical requirements specify that lead technicians must hold a NICET Level II certification or higher in Fire Alarm Systems and possess at least three years of experience. Additionally, personnel must have manufacturer training or equivalent experience with SimplexGrinnell, Honeywell FCI, and Edwards EST systems. All work must comply with OSHA 29 CFR 1910, NFPA 72, NFPA 70, and the 2021 International Fire Code. Award will be based on the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) process, evaluating offerors on technical capability, biobased product certifications, and relevant past performance. Payment is processed electronically through the U.S. Department of the Treasury's Invoice Processing Platform (IPP), requiring a pencil copy of pay applications to be reviewed by the Contracting Officer's Representative before formal submission. Deliverables include detailed inspection and recommendation reports for each building, submitted within ten working days of completion, and the placement of inspection tags on all serviced equipment.
